Understanding the Purpose of Venting
Picture a water-filled pipe. As water rushes through, it creates an immense force, much like a powerful river current. This force, known as "negative pressure," can cause havoc within your plumbing system. It has the ability to suck fixtures, traps, and even entire sections of the DWV system, leading to a symphony of gurgling sounds, unpleasant odors, and potentially hazardous sewer gas infiltration.
Venting, in essence, is the ingenious solution to counteract this negative pressure. By strategically placing vent pipes, we create an escape route for air to enter the system, breaking the negative pressure cycle and ensuring the smooth flow of waste and wastewater. It's like opening a window to let fresh air in, allowing your plumbing system to breathe and function effortlessly.
Benefits of a Properly Vented DWV System
The advantages of a properly vented DWV system extend far beyond preventing gurgling noises and foul smells. Let's explore some of the key benefits:
-
Odor Control: Vents act as odor barriers, preventing sewer gases from escaping into your living space. These gases, often containing harmful bacteria and unpleasant odors, can pose health risks and make your home an unpleasant place to be. Proper venting ensures these gases are safely expelled outdoors, keeping your indoor air fresh and healthy.
-
Improved Drainage: A well-vented DWV system facilitates efficient drainage by allowing air to enter the system, eliminating the negative pressure that can impede the flow of wastewater. This results in faster drainage, reducing the likelihood of clogs and backups, and keeping your drains flowing smoothly.
-
Protects Fixtures and Traps: The negative pressure created by unvented DWV systems can exert immense force on fixtures and traps, potentially causing damage or even dislodging them from their connections. Proper venting alleviates this pressure, safeguarding your fixtures and traps and preventing costly repairs.
-
Prevents Sewer Gas Infiltration: Sewer gas, a toxic mixture of gases produced by the decomposition of organic matter in wastewater, can pose serious health risks if it infiltrates your home. Proper venting prevents sewer gas from seeping into your living space, protecting your family and pets from harmful contaminants.
-
Compliance with Codes and Regulations: Most municipalities have strict codes and regulations governing the installation and maintenance of DWV systems, including requirements for proper venting. Complying with these regulations ensures your plumbing system meets safety and health standards, avoiding potential legal issues and costly fines.

FAQs
- What happens if my DWV system is not vented?
Without proper venting, your DWV system can experience a range of issues, including gurgling noises, slow drainage, clogs, sewer gas infiltration, and damage to fixtures and traps. It can also compromise indoor air quality and pose health risks.
- How do I know if my DWV system is properly vented?
A qualified plumber can inspect your DWV system to determine if it is properly vented. They will assess the location, size, and condition of the vent pipes to ensure they meet code requirements and provide adequate ventilation.
- How often should I have my DWV system inspected?
It is recommended to have your DWV system inspected at least once every two years by a qualified plumber. This will help identify any potential issues early on and prevent costly repairs or replacements.
- Can I vent my DWV system myself?
While it is possible to DIY DWV venting, it is highly recommended to hire a qualified plumber for this task. Venting requires specialized knowledge and expertise to ensure proper installation and compliance with codes and regulations.
- What are the signs of a clogged vent pipe?
Clogged vent pipes can manifest in various ways, including gurgling sounds from drains, slow drainage, frequent clogs, and sewer gas odors. If you notice any of these signs, it's essential to call a plumber immediately to inspect and clear the vent pipe.
